簡體   English   中英

Xcode評論自動完成(appledoc風格)

[英]Xcode comments autocompletion (appledoc style)

我發現記錄我的界面特別痛苦,因為我需要自己輸入一切。 所以我認為我不應該是唯一一個這樣的人,並開始尋找一種方法來減輕我的痛苦,但沒有找到太多。

我的問題是,是否有一個快捷方式或方法讓Xcode自動完成我的評論? 例如,我非常喜歡輸入/** + [tab]它自動填充到:

/**
 * [cursor here]
 * 
 * (maybe some pre-populate a list of arguments for the method below)
 */
- (void)test:(NSString *)testString another:(NSString *)another;

謝謝!

使用Xcode的代碼段功能。 您可以創建包含所需文本的代碼段,並在要填寫的文本中添加項目。要創建代碼段,只需在Xcode編輯器中選擇一些文本並將其拖到代碼段庫中。 您可以設置完成快捷方式,因此m-comment可能是您的標准方法注釋:

片段編輯器

鍵入m-comment的第一位然后顯示整個快捷方式(以及任何其他完成),並接受完成添加注釋,參數化部分等待填寫。像往常一樣,您可以從一個選項卡到下一個:

插入評論

您指示文本的給定部分是要填寫的字段,方法是將其<#method name#><##> ,例如: <#method name#>

當然,Objective-C的優勢之一是方法名稱通常會告訴您參數是什么。 在評論中重復這一點似乎是不必要的額外工作。 Xcode 3更好地支持包含腳本的腳本,這些腳本會自動生成帶參數的HeaderDoc注釋。 但是,它們並沒有被廣泛使用,可能是因為這些評論並沒有真正有用。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M